Why Heat Pumps Are a Smart Fit for South Texas
South Texas has mild winters, making heat pump systems an excellent choice for many homeowners. A heat pump moves heat rather than generating it, enabling it to handle both cooling and heating with a single energy-efficient system. During the summer months, it functions like a standard air conditioner. During cooler weather, it reverses the process, bringing warmth into the home. In our climate, a heat pump effectively covers both jobs and costs less to operate than two separate systems.

Common heat pump repair warning signs include:
- The system is blowing cold air while in heating mode.
- Continuous running without reaching the set temperature.
- Ice buildup on the outdoor unit outside of normal defrost cycles.
